Pipette use, maintenance and care

1. Scope

This standard applies to pipette use, maintenance and servicing.
2. Content
A complete pipetting cycle includes six steps: tip installation-volume setting-pre-washing tip-aspiration-dispensing-removing the tip. Each step has an operation specification to be followed.
1. Tip installation:
The correct installation method is called the rotary installation method. The specific method is to insert the tip of the white sleeve into the suction head (whether it is a bulk suction head or a boxed suction head), and while gently pressing down, move the handle The liquid container rotates 180 degrees counterclockwise. Remember not to use too much force, let alone the method of chopping the tip, because doing so will cause unnecessary damage to the pipette in your hand.
2. Capacity setting:
The correct capacity setting is divided into two steps, one is coarse adjustment, that is, the capacity value is quickly adjusted to close to its expected value through the discharge button; the second is fine adjustment, when the capacity value is close to its expected value, it should be moved The liquid container is placed horizontally and placed horizontally in front of your eyes, and the volume value is slowly adjusted to the expected value through the adjustment wheel, so as to avoid the effects of visual errors.
When setting the capacity, there is another area that needs special attention. When we adjust from a large value to a small value, it is just fine; but when adjusting from a small value to a large value, we need to adjust more than one third of the circle and then return. This is because there is a certain gap in the counter that needs to be made up.
3. Pre-washed tips:
After we install a new tip or increase the volume value, we should suck and discharge the liquid to be transferred two or three times. This is to make the inner wall of the tip form a homogeneous liquid film to ensure the accuracy of the pipetting work And accuracy, so that the entire pipetting process has a very high reproducibility. Secondly, when absorbing organic solvents or highly volatile liquids, volatile gases will form a negative pressure in the white sleeve chamber, resulting in liquid leakage. At this time, we need to pre-wash four to six times to let the white sleeve chamber When the gas reaches saturation, the negative pressure will automatically disappear.
4. Aspiration:
First press the pipette discharge button to the first stop point, and then immerse the tip vertically into the liquid surface, the immersion depth is: P2, P10 is less than or equal to 1 mm, P20, P100, P200 is less than or equal to 2 mm, P1000 is less than Or equal to 3 mm, P5ML, P10ML is less than or equal to 4 mm (if immersed too deep, hydraulic pressure will have a certain effect on the accuracy of suction, of course, the specific immersion depth should also be flexibly controlled according to the size of the container holding the liquid) , Release the button smoothly, remember not to be too fast.
5. Drain:
When dispensing liquid, the tip is close to the container wall, first press the discharge button to the first stop point, after a short pause, then press to the second stop point, this can ensure that there is no residual liquid in the tip. If there is residual liquid in this operation, you should consider replacing the tip.
6. Remove the tip:
The removed tip must not be mixed with the new tip to avoid cross-contamination.
Two-minute inspection method:
This is a simple method that can be used to quickly check the pipette in the hand. Through the inspection, we can determine whether the pipette in our hands is in a normal working state.
1. Leak detection:
The pipette in our hands is called an air displacement pipette. If there is a leak, our sampling results will definitely not be accurate, which will directly affect the final result of our experiment. The consequences are more serious. . So, how to judge whether the pipette is leaking? This requires us to do a simple test on it. First, take a transparent container and fill it with water. Put the pipette that needs to be tested on the tip and suck up the water. P200 pipette, please immerse the tip into the liquid surface 1-2 mm, wait for 20 seconds, observe whether the liquid level inside the tip drops, if it drops, it means that the pipette in your hand is leaking. Situation; If it is a P1000, P5000, P10ML pipette, hang the tip down for 20 seconds and observe if there is any liquid dripping. If there is, it means that the pipette in your hand is also leaking. What if there is a leak?
2. Find the cause of the fault:
First, check whether the tip is installed properly, replace the tip and test again to eliminate the leakage caused by the relationship of the tip; then, check the port portion of the white sleeve (that is, the portion where the white sleeve contacts the tip) If there are scratches; then, check whether the connecting nut between the white sleeve and the handle is loose. If none of these conditions, it means that the seal ring or piston assembly is damaged, please contact us, we will come to you to solve it.
3. Check the appearance:
Press the discharge button to see if it feels smooth, listen to whether there is noise, and observe whether the discharge rod is bent; rotate the adjustment button to observe whether the reading of the counter deviates.

maintenance:
1. Regularly clean the pipette in our hands with alcohol cotton. Mainly wipe the outside of the handle, the ejector and the white sleeve, which can not only keep the appearance beautiful, but also reduce the possibility of contamination of the sample.
2. After absorbing excessively volatile and highly corrosive liquid, the whole pipette should be disassembled, and the piston rod and the inner wall of the white sleeve should be rinsed with distilled water, and then installed after being dried. In order to prevent volatile gas from adsorbing on the surface of the piston rod for a long time, it will corrode the piston rod and damage your pipette.
